Description
This Knightsbridge 24V LED strip light delivers 560 lumens per metre from 64 SMD 2835 LEDs in a 3000K warm white colour temperature. The 1m length is encased in a 10mm-wide silicone coating that carries an IP67 rating, protecting the electronics from dust ingress and temporary immersion in water up to 1m depth for up to 30 minutes. The strip consumes 4.8W per metre and runs on a 24V DC constant voltage driver, sold separately.
Designed for cove lighting, under-cabinet installations, outdoor architectural accent lighting and waterproof applications where traditional IP20 strip would fail, the IP67 silicone coating allows the strip to be used in bathrooms, kitchens, outdoor canopies, and any location where moisture or dust is present. The strip can be cut at 125mm intervals to fit the required length, and each cut section requires an IP end cap (LFCFIX10, sold separately) to maintain the IP67 rating. The 3M self-adhesive backing allows the strip to be fixed directly to clean, dry surfaces without additional brackets.
The 120-degree beam angle provides even wash lighting across surfaces without visible LED hotspots. The strip is dimmable when paired with a compatible 24V dimming driver and controller, allowing brightness adjustment from full 560lm output down to low ambient levels. Maximum continuous run length is 20m before voltage drop affects output and colour consistency. For runs longer than 20m, the strip requires a second driver feeding from the opposite end. The silicone coating adds approximately 2mm of thickness compared to bare PCB strips, bringing total projection to around 7mm from the mounting surface.

Frequently Asked
Can this be used outdoors?
Yes. The IP67 silicone coating protects the strip from dust and water ingress, making it suitable for outdoor installations under canopies, in covered walkways, or anywhere the strip will not be permanently submerged. The IP67 rating allows temporary immersion up to 1m depth for up to 30 minutes.
What driver does it need?
This strip requires a 24V DC constant voltage driver. For a 1m length drawing 4.8W, a driver rated at 10W or higher is recommended to allow headroom. Knightsbridge produces a range of compatible drivers, sold separately. If dimming is required, choose a dimmable 24V driver and pair it with a compatible controller.
Can I cut it to a shorter length?
Yes. The strip can be cut at 125mm intervals where marked on the PCB. Each cut section requires an IP end cap (LFCFIX10, sold separately) to seal the cut end and maintain the IP67 rating. Cutting at any point other than the marked intervals will damage the LEDs.
How is it installed?
The strip is supplied with 3M self-adhesive backing. Clean and dry the mounting surface, peel the backing tape, and press the strip firmly into place. For heavier-duty mounting or overhead installations, Knightsbridge produces a separate fixing kit (FLEXFIX, sold separately) that holds the strip in aluminium profile.
